ABSTRACT

Currently, standardized magnetic resonance imaging (MRI) scoring systems and protocols for assessment of idiopathic inflammatory myopathies (IIMs) in children and adults are lacking. Therefore, we will perform a scoping review of the literature to collate and evaluate the existing semi-quantitative and quantitative MRI scoring systems and protocols for the assessment and monitoring of skeletal muscle involvement in patients with IIMs. The aim is to compile evidence-based information that will facilitate the future development of a universal standardized MRI scoring system for both research and clinical applications in IIM. A systematic search of electronic databases (PubMed, EMBASE, and Cochrane) will be undertaken to identify relevant articles published between January 2000 and October 2023. Data will be synthesized narratively. This scoping review seeks to comprehensively summarize and evaluate the evidence on the scanning protocols and scoring systems used in the assessment of diagnosis, disease activity, and damage using skeletal muscle MRI in IIMs. The results will allow the development of consensus recommendations for clinical practice and enable the standardization of research methods for the MRI assessment of skeletal muscle changes in patients with IIMs.

ABSTRACT

OBJECTIVES: TNF inhibitors (TNFi) have dramatically changed the prognosis of juvenile idiopathic arthritis (JIA), but it is not clear how and when stop therapy. We aim to describe a multicentric cohort of JIA treated with adalimumab or etanercept who discontinued the treatment for persistent inactivity and to identify factors associated with relapse. METHODS: In a multicentric Italian retrospective cohort study, medical records of patients with oligoarticular and polyarticular JIA were evaluated if they stopped therapy for persistent inactivity after the first TNFi. RESULTS: 136 patients were enrolled (102 female, median age at onset 3 years (range 1-15), of whom 55.9% had oligoJIA, 40.4% uveitis and 72.8% ANA positivity. Adalimumab (59.3%) and etanercept (40.7%) were started at a median age of 6 years (range 1-16), TNFi were discontinued after a median time of 30 months (range 6-90), increasing the interval (76.5%), reducing the dose (18.4%) and abrupt discontinuation (16.9%). 79.4% of patients relapsed after a median time of 5 months (range 0.5-66). Patients with uveitis relapsed earlier (log rank χ² 16.4 p<0.0001), while patients who lengthened the interval of administration showed a later relapse (log rank χ² 6.95 p=0.008). Uveitis (HR 2.11 CI 1.34-3.31), age at onset (HR 0.909 CI 0.836-0.987), duration of tapering (HR 0.938 CI 0.893-0.985) and to have a persistent OligoJIA (HR 0.597 CI 0.368-0.968) are significant predictors of disease relapse (Mantel-Cox χ² 34.23 p<0.001). CONCLUSIONS: Younger age at onset, uveitis, duration of tapering, and not-persistent OligoJIA seem to be independent risk factors for earlier relapse after the first TNFi withdrawal.

ABSTRACT

PURPOSE: Data on acute hemorrhagic edema of infancy (AHEI) are derived from small case series or case reports. We report a 20-year experience at a national referral center. METHODS: We performed a single-center retrospective study including patients who were diagnosed with AHEI from January 1, 2004, to June 30, 2023. RESULTS: We identified 21 patients (57.1% females) with a median age of 18 months (range 7-33 months). Thirteen (61.9%) patients were admitted to the pediatric ward, the remaining eight (38.1%) presented to the emergency department and were discharged for outpatient management. The median length of hospitalization was 5 days (range 3-9 days). Twenty patients (95.2%) had prodromal symptoms. The most common cutaneous findings were targetoid purpuric plaques. The lesions were most localized on the face (13, 61.9%) and on the upper limbs (18 patients, 85.7%). Sixteen (76%) patients presented with nonpitting and tender edema, localized on the feet (9/16, 56%) and hands (6/16, 37.5%). Systemic involvement was rare, and no patients experienced complications or sequelae. Twelve (57.1%) patients underwent infectious disease investigations, with positive results in only four (33.3%). None of the patients diagnosed after the SARS-CoV-2 outbreak (March 2020) had positive nasopharyngeal swabs for the virus. For the 13 patients who were admitted to the pediatric ward, the median length of hospitalization was five days (3-9 days). CONCLUSIONS: The 21-patient single-center cohort of children affected by AHEI confirmed a generally benign course of AHEI, despite a 62% rate of hospitalization.

ABSTRACT

Objective: Since adalimumab approval in childhood chronic non-infectious uveitis (cNIU), the prognosis has been dramatically changed, but the 25 % failed to achieve inactivity. There is not accordance if it is better to switch to another anti-TNF or to swap to another category of biologic. Thus, we aim to summarize evidence regarding the best treatment of cNIU refractory to the first anti-TNF. Methods: A systematic literature review and meta-analysis, according to PRISMA Guidelines, was performed(Jan2000-Aug2023). Studies investigating the efficacy of treatment in cNIU refractory to the first anti-TNF were considered for inclusion. The primary outcome was the improvement of intraocular inflammation according to SUN. A combined estimation of the proportion of children responding to switch or swap and for each drug was performed. Results: 23 articles were eligible, reporting 150 children of whom 109 switched anti-TNF (45 adalimumab, 49 infliximab, 9 golimumab) and 41 swapped to another biologics (31 abatacept, 8 tocilizumab and 1 rituximab). The proportion of responding children was 46 %(95 % CI 23-70) for switch and 38 %(95 % CI 8-73) for swap (χ20.02, p = 0.86). Instead analysing for each drug, the proportion of responding children was the 24 %(95 % CI 2-55) for adalimumab, 43 %(95 % CI 2-80) for abatacept, 79 %(95 % CI 61-93) for infliximab, 56 %(95 % CI 14-95) for golimumab and 96 %(95 % CI 58-100) for tocilizumab. We evaluated a superiority of tocilizumab and infliximab compared to the other drugs(χ2 27.5 p < 0.0001). Conclusion: Although non-conclusive, this meta-analysis suggests that, after the first anti-TNF failure, tocilizumab and infliximab are the best available treatment for the management of cNIU.

ABSTRACT

OBJECTIVES: To compare Kawasaki disease (KD) and multisystem inflammatory syndrome (MIS-C) in children. METHODS: Prospective collection of demographics, clinical and treatment data. Assessment of type 1 interferon (IFN) score, CXCL9, CXCL10, Interleukin (IL)18, IFNγ, IL6, IL1b at disease onset and at recovery. RESULTS: 87 patients (43 KD, 44 MIS-C) were included. Age was higher in MIS-C compared to KD group (mean 31±23 vs. 94±50 months, p<0.001). Extremities abnormalities (p=0.027), mucosal involvement (p<0.001), irritability (p<0.001), gallbladder hydrops (p=0.01) and lymphadenopathy (p=0.07) were more often recorded in KD. Neurological findings (p=0.002), gastrointestinal symptoms (p=0.013), respiratory involvement (p=0.019) and splenomegaly (p=0.026) were more frequently observed in MIS-C. Cardiac manifestations were higher in MIS-C (p<0.001), although coronary aneurisms were more frequent in KD (p=0.012). In the MIS-C group, the multiple linear regression analysis revealed that a higher IFN score at onset was related to myocardial disfunction (p<0.001), lymphadenopathy (p=<0.001) and need of ventilation (p=0.024). Both CXCL9 and CXCL10 were related to myocardial disfunction (p<0.001 and p=0.029). IL18 was positively associated to PICU admission (0.030) and ventilation (p=004) and negatively associated to lymphadenopathy (0.004). IFNγ values were related to neurological involvement and lymphadenopathy (p<0.001), IL1b to hearth involvement (0.006). A negative correlation has been observed between IL6 values, heart involvement (p=0.013) and PICU admission (p<0.001). CONCLUSIONS: The demographic and clinical differences between KD e MIS-C cohorts confirm previous reported data. The assessment of biomarkers levels at MIS-C onset could be useful to predict a more severe disease course and the development of cardiac complications.

ABSTRACT

OBJECTIVE: Our objective was to develop and validate cutoff values in the systemic Juvenile Arthritis Disease Activity Score 10 (sJADAS10) that distinguish the states of inactive disease (ID), minimal disease activity (MDA), moderate disease activity (MoDA), and high disease activity (HDA) in children with systemic juvenile idiopathic arthritis, based on subjective disease state assessment by the treating pediatric rheumatologist. METHODS: The cutoff definition cohort was composed of 400 patients enrolled at 30 pediatric rheumatology centers in 11 countries. Using the subjective physician rating as an external criterion, six methods were applied to identify the cutoffs: mapping, calculation of percentiles of cumulative score distribution, the Youden index, 90% specificity, maximum agreement, and receiver operating characteristic curve analysis. Sixty percent of the patients were assigned to the definition cohort, and 40% were assigned to the validation cohort. Cutoff validation was conducted by assessing discriminative ability. RESULTS: The sJADAS10 cutoffs that separated ID from MDA, MDA from MoDA, and MoDA from HDA were ≤2.9, ≤10, and >20.6, respectively. The cutoffs discriminated strongly among different levels of pain, between patients with and without morning stiffness, and among patients whose parents judged their disease status as remission or persistent activity or flare or were satisfied or not satisfied with current illness outcome. CONCLUSION: The sJADAS cutoffs revealed good metrologic properties in both definition and validation cohorts and are therefore suitable for use in clinical trials and routine practice.

ABSTRACT

OBJECTIVE: Childhood Mixed Connective Tissue Disease (cMCTD) is the rarest pediatric connective tissue disease that includes features of systemic lupus erythematosus, polymyositis/dermatomyositis, juvenile idiopathic arthritis, and systemic sclerosis, identified by Sharp in 1972 and whose diagnosis remains challenging. This systematic review aims to identify clinical features at the onset of cMCTD and manifestations not currently included into the available diagnostic criteria. METHODS: A systematic literature review was performed in accordance with PRISMA guidelines 2020 using bibliographic databases: MEDLINE via PubMed and EMBASE. ELIGIBILITY CRITERIA: patients diagnosed with MCTD with onset before 18 years. STUDIES INCLUDED: registries, retrospective and prospective cohort studies, case series and reports with analysis of data on signs and symptoms of presentation. RESULTS: 39 articles were included (215 subjects, 82.5% female), mean age of 141 months (± 41 months DS, range 2.5-204). The most used criteria for the diagnosis of MCTD were the Kasukawa criteria (54.5%). The clinical manifestations described at onset were Raynaud's phenomenon (69.7%), arthritis (60.9%), muscular involvement (53.5%), dermatological signs (39.5%), swollen fingers or hands (29.3%), arthralgias (25.6%), fever (22.3%), lung involvement (14.4%), sclerodactily (13.5%), lymphadenopathy (10.7%) serositis (10.2%), esophageal involvement (6.9%), nervous system involvement (6.9%), xeroftalmia (3.7%), xerostomia (3.7%), hepatosplenomegaly (2.8%), cardiac involvement (2.8%), hepatitis (2.3%), parotiditis (2.3%), Hashimoto's thyroiditis (0.9%), ocular involvement (0.9%). CONCLUSIONS: The data from this systematic review suggest great heterogeneity of the clinical presentation of cMCTD for which there are no validated diagnostic criteria that may suggest a new diagnostic approach to allow earlier or more accurate diagnosis in the future.

ABSTRACT

INTRODUCTION: Juvenile systemic sclerosis (jSSc) is an orphan disease with a prevalence of 3 in 1,000,000 children. Currently there is only one consensus treatment guideline concerning skin, pulmonary and vascular involvement for jSSc, the jSSc SHARE (Single Hub and Access point for pediatric Rheumatology in Europe) initiative, which was based on data procured up to 2014. Therefore, an update of these guidelines, with a more recent literature and expert experience, and extension of the guidance to more aspects of the disease is needed. AREAS COVERED: Treatment options were reviewed, and opinions were provided for most facets of jSSc including general management, some of which differs from adult systemic sclerosis, such as the use of corticosteroids, and specific organ involvement, such as skin, musculoskeletal, pulmonary, and gastroenterology. EXPERT OPINION: We are suggesting the treat to target strategy to treat early to prevent cumulative disease damage in jSSc. Conclusions are derived from both expert opinion and available literature, which is mostly based on adult systemic sclerosis (aSSc), given shared pathophysiology, extrapolation of results from aSSc studies was judged reasonable.
